Who was the Soviet leader and reformer who began the process of restructuring the Soviet economy?

Mikhail Gorbachev was the Soviet leader who in 1985 began the process of restructuring of the Soviet economy, known as perestroika accompanied by the policy of liberalization, known as glasnost.
